Transaction 4317d43e661577cf33a2708f336747cde956a4eb231c64f7997a532676565487
1 Input
1 Output
-
4317d43e661577cf33a2708f336747cde956a4eb231c64f7997a532676565487:0
- value
- 103144335
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17a7cdba2c358c034773379e7da52fd826bdf70a OP_EQUAL
- address
- MA4Eo3QhhN1rp21w23zRDfCnmj6QZ6CeYE